What Is Civil Litigation?

Civil litigation refers to legal disputes between individuals, businesses, or government entities that are resolved in civil courts. Unlike criminal cases, civil litigation seeks to address issues such as financial compensation, enforcement of contracts, or injunctions rather than criminal penalties. It encompasses a broad spectrum of legal conflicts, including personal injury, discrimination, and business disputes.

Key Components of the Civil Litigation Process

The civil litigation process involves several key stages beginning with the filing of a complaint to initiate a lawsuit. Following this, both parties engage in discovery to exchange relevant information and evidence. Negotiations or mediation may occur to seek settlement options. If no agreement is reached, the case proceeds to trial where a judge or jury renders a decision, with the possibility of appeals afterward.

Important Terms and Glossary for Civil Litigation

Understanding common legal terms helps clients navigate civil litigation more confidently. Below are explanations of important terminology frequently encountered during the process.

Complaint

A formal legal document filed by the plaintiff that initiates a lawsuit by outlining the facts and legal reasons for the claim against the defendant.

Discovery

A pre-trial phase where both parties exchange information, documents, and evidence relevant to the case to prepare for trial or settlement discussions.

Settlement

An agreement reached between the parties to resolve the dispute without proceeding to trial, often involving compensation or other terms.

Trial

A formal court proceeding where both sides present evidence and arguments before a judge or jury, who then make a decision on the case.

Comparing Legal Options for Civil Disputes

When addressing civil disputes, individuals may choose between informal negotiation, mediation, arbitration, or full litigation. Informal negotiation can be quicker but may lack enforceability. Mediation and arbitration offer alternative dispute resolution methods that can be less costly and time-consuming than court trials. However, litigation is necessary when disputes require formal legal determination and enforcement.

The discovery process in civil litigation involves exchanging information, documents, and evidence between the parties. This phase includes written interrogatories, requests for production of documents, and depositions of witnesses. Discovery is essential to prepare for trial and evaluate settlement options. Alternative dispute resolution options include mediation and arbitration, which offer less formal settings to resolve disputes without trial. Mediation involves a neutral third party facilitating negotiations to reach a voluntary agreement, while arbitration results in a binding decision by the arbitrator. These methods can be more cost-effective and quicker than traditional litigation, but may not be suitable for all cases.
